1. Set Your Finances


The first and most important action is establishing a realistic budget. Figure out how much you're able to invest on the complete project, from buying the land to end-stage interior finishes. This financial plan should account for all costs, including:

  • Land purchase

  • Building resources and labor

  • Architectural and architectural fees

  • Permits and reviews

  • Unforeseen expenses (it’s smart to set aside at least 10-15% of your budget for contingencies)


Once you have a well-defined financial plan, you can avoid unnecessary surprises down the road and make informed decisions about the scale of your build.

2. Search for and Buy the Right Land


Setting is everything. Whether you're looking for a peaceful countryside area or a lively city-based neighborhood, choosing the right land is critical. Before sealing the deal, confirm the land meets your needs and check factors like:

  • Zoning laws and building restrictions

  • Access to utilities (water, gas, electricity, sewage)

  • Soil quality and water flow

  • Proximity to schools, hospitals, and services


Additionally, it’s a wise choice to arrange the land inspected and evaluated to prevent any unexpected issues that could make difficult the building journey.

3. Select the Right Design and Architect


Now that you’ve set a budget and selected the land, it’s time to design your ideal home. Whether you’re imagining a warm cottage or Home page a modern, chic design, collaborating with an professional architect is important. Your architect will help you:

  • Interpret regional building codes and laws

  • Create a home that suits your preferences

  • Increase the use of space and sun light

  • Include green and energy-efficient solutions


Be sure to share your dream and priorities clearly with your architect. This step is where your ideas come together, and the more open you are about your desires, the better the final result will fit your goal.

4. Select a Experienced Contractor


Hiring the right contractor to bring to life your dream is vital to the achievement of your home. A experienced contractor will bring your design to life while adhering to the defined time frame and budget. When searching for a contractor, consider the following:

  • Testimonials and past experiences from previous clients

  • Experience with related builds

  • Certification and coverage

  • A clear quote system


It’s also helpful to interview several contractors to choose someone you feel confident collaborating with. Don’t rush this decision—selecting the right team can determine the difference between a smooth process and a complicated one.
